LinuxSir.Org  
| 网站首页 | 论坛帮助 |

欢迎来到LinuxSir.Org!
您还未登录,请登录后查看论坛,或者点击论坛上方的注册链接注册新账号。


发表新主题 回复
 
主题工具
旧 10-07-16, 01:56 第 1 帖
jqxl0205 帅哥
 
 
 
注册会员  
  注册日期: Dec 2007
  帖子: 526
  精华: 0
 

标题: FCITX UTF8 可以保留FCITX先前的那种样子吗?


fcitx utf8加皮肤了,使用后感觉效果不是太好,有一个想法,可不可以在皮肤的基础保留先前那种用文件配置的样式的那种方式。







__________________
K.I.S.S

ArchLinux 2.6.37
  jqxl0205 当前离线   回复时引用此帖
旧 10-07-16, 11:14 第 2 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: jqxl0205
fcitx utf8加皮肤了,使用后感觉效果不是太好,有一个想法,可不可以在皮肤的基础保留先前那种用文件配置的样式的那种方式。
……这,该删的代码都删了……只能以后再说了……

其实对颜色不满意可以用那个default改着玩玩
  hurricanek 当前离线   回复时引用此帖
旧 10-07-16, 16:41 第 3 帖
jqxl0205 帅哥
 
 
 
注册会员  
  注册日期: Dec 2007
  帖子: 526
  精华: 0
 

我总觉得改用图片后,fcitx的反映速度没有先前的快,utf-8的不提供先前的那种方式,只好换回非utf8的那个了,虽然utf8版本的那个要好些。
  jqxl0205 当前离线   回复时引用此帖
旧 10-07-17, 00:58 第 4 帖
jarryson 帅哥
 
jarryson 的头像
 
 
注册会员  
  注册日期: Jul 2004
  我的住址: 湖北武汉
  帖子: 5,928
  精华: 3
 

这影响反映速度的话。。。那CPU可能非常非常低的主频才能察觉吧。。。







__________________
AMD Turion MT-34 1.8G,1G+256M ddr333,VIA,AMD-ATI X700 128M,160G IDE,15.4宽...

Archlinux -- 最新,最快,最方便
  jarryson 当前离线   回复时引用此帖
旧 10-07-17, 01:16 第 5 帖
jqxl0205 帅哥
 
 
 
注册会员  
  注册日期: Dec 2007
  帖子: 526
  精华: 0
 

我经常是键都敲完了,字还没有出来,那个出字的框也没有出来。
  jqxl0205 当前离线   回复时引用此帖
旧 10-07-18, 02:17 第 6 帖
lastart
 
 
 
注册会员  
  注册日期: Feb 2004
  帖子: 912
  精华: 0
 

呵呵,这就叫众口调啊,fcitx本来就是以小巧取胜。
现在的UTF-8分支感觉正在逐渐地变成另外一个软件呢。

能不能考虑以r366分岔点弄另一个分支出来?

此帖于 10-07-18 04:11 被 lastart 编辑.
  lastart 当前离线   回复时引用此帖
旧 10-07-18, 14:39 第 7 帖
jqxl0205 帅哥
 
 
 
注册会员  
  注册日期: Dec 2007
  帖子: 526
  精华: 0
 

觉得utf-8的皮肤可以做,但最好是可选的。

而且那个皮肤在没有开启复合效果的时候周围一圈都是黑色的,不太好看。
  jqxl0205 当前离线   回复时引用此帖
旧 10-07-18, 18:21 第 8 帖
realasking
 
realasking 的头像
 
 
注册会员  
  注册日期: Sep 2008
  帖子: 859
  精华: 0
 

有皮肤的版本在我的fvwm上表现不正常,桌面背景经常被“透视”到当前窗口,
而且发到开发者的网站也没有见到回复,皮肤如果透明,又必须开桌面效果才支持,
不然就有一大圈黑色,所以我也只好暂时换回不支持皮肤的版本了。







__________________
CPU: Pentium Dual-Core T4400
RAM: DDR 3 1333 3G
M/B: Nvidia MCP79+ Geforce 310M

Desktop:
1.Windows 2008R2 with OFFICE 2010+Tex Live 2011+KDE 4.7.0
2.Fedora 12 x86_64+KDE 4.5.2 + fvwm with OpenOffice+Tex Live 2011
3.Arch Linux + fluxbox + KDE 4.7.0

My blog:
http://hi.baidu.com/realasking
  realasking 当前离线   回复时引用此帖
旧 10-07-19, 19:11 第 9 帖
jqxl0205 帅哥
 
 
 
注册会员  
  注册日期: Dec 2007
  帖子: 526
  精华: 0
 

嗯,我也换回没有皮肤的了。不过utf-8版本的最近好几个版本都是有皮肤的,没有办法只好使用fcitx-svn的了。
  jqxl0205 当前离线   回复时引用此帖
旧 10-07-20, 14:22 第 10 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: realasking
有皮肤的版本在我的fvwm上表现不正常,桌面背景经常被“透视”到当前窗口,
而且发到开发者的网站也没有见到回复,皮肤如果透明,又必须开桌面效果才支持,
不然就有一大圈黑色,所以我也只好暂时换回不支持皮肤的版本了。
抱歉……后来忘了你这个report了,已经回复你了
引用:
我刚刚安装了fvwm,貌似没有发现你说的问题

FVWM version 2.4.20 compiled on Jun 18 2009 at 20:25:42
with support for: ReadLine, Stroke, XPM, GNOME WM hints, Shape, SM, Xinerama

不过既然2.5.*属于unstable……出问题也属正常了?……

因为kwin,metacity,xfwm4,icewm,pekwm,awesome(我把我知道的所有wm都测试了一次……),都没有遇到你说的问题,建议你去和fvwm报bug。
  hurricanek 当前离线   回复时引用此帖
旧 10-07-20, 14:24 第 11 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: jqxl0205
我经常是键都敲完了,字还没有出来,那个出字的框也没有出来。
那请问一下你所有的gtk程序工作都正常否?cairo在电脑上不至于有如此严重的性能问题吧(gtk也是用cairo绘制的……)
  hurricanek 当前离线   回复时引用此帖
旧 10-07-20, 14:28 第 12 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: jqxl0205
觉得utf-8的皮肤可以做,但最好是可选的。

而且那个皮肤在没有开启复合效果的时候周围一圈都是黑色的,不太好看。
说到黑框,cairo-dock,awn,不开混合一样黑框……

所以一开始我就做了一个矩形的皮肤(比较难看我也承认……花了一点时间用gimp随便画画了事的)

老实说,搜狗的默认界面也是矩形,其实多数人对那个界面其实没有意见吧?有空我把默认的界面改改……这个问题我觉得可以回避的
  hurricanek 当前离线   回复时引用此帖
旧 10-07-20, 14:37 第 13 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: lastart
呵呵,这就叫众口调啊,fcitx本来就是以小巧取胜。
现在的UTF-8分支感觉正在逐渐地变成另外一个软件呢。

能不能考虑以r366分岔点弄另一个分支出来?
其实并没有,我在开发的时候依旧把这一条记在心里呢。目前相比较原来,多了cairo,少了libxpm,依赖并不多。我要是把这个忘了……早就glib,pango什么的往上扔了,当时和skin支持的维护者讨论的时候也纠结了半天究竟用什么库的问题。

在不久的将来将加入gettext,剩余架构上一直没有变过。
  hurricanek 当前离线   回复时引用此帖
旧 10-07-20, 17:11 第 14 帖
realasking
 
realasking 的头像
 
 
注册会员  
  注册日期: Sep 2008
  帖子: 859
  精华: 0
 

引用:
作者: hurricanek
抱歉……后来忘了你这个report了,已经回复你了
我看到你的回复后把fvwm升级到了2.5.30,然后就正常了,谢谢。
不过现在在用r387的时候,在stalonetry托盘上看不到fcitx的图标了,
请问可能是什么原因呢?
按configure的help加--enable-tray参数后编译,提示如下错误:
代码:
In function `main': /backup/Download/fcitx-read-utf8/src/core/main.c:233: undefined reference to `tray' /backup/Download/fcitx-read-utf8/src/core/main.c:235: undefined reference to `CreateTrayWindow' /backup/Download/fcitx-read-utf8/src/core/main.c:236: undefined reference to `tray' /backup/Download/fcitx-read-utf8/src/core/main.c:236: undefined reference to `DrawTrayWindow' /backup/Download/fcitx-read-utf8/src/core/main.c:233: undefined reference to `tray' ../tools/libtools.a(tools.o):(.data+0x48): undefined reference to `bUseTrayIcon' collect2: ld 返回 1 make[3]: *** [fcitx] 错误 1 make[3]: Leaving directory `/backup/Download/fcitx-read-utf8/src/core' make[2]: *** [all-recursive] 错误 1 make[2]: Leaving directory `/backup/Download/fcitx-read-utf8/src' make[1]: *** [all-recursive] 错误 1 make[1]: Leaving directory `/backup/Download/fcitx-read-utf8' make: *** [all] 错误 2


===============================
找到原因了,这次是网络问题,文件有错误,重新更新了一下,加--enable-tray参数就正常了。

此帖于 10-07-20 18:43 被 realasking 编辑.
  realasking 当前离线   回复时引用此帖
旧 10-07-20, 21:31 第 15 帖
hurricanek
 
 
 
注册会员  
  注册日期: Jun 2008
  帖子: 530
  精华: 0
 

引用:
作者: realasking
我看到你的回复后把fvwm升级到了2.5.30,然后就正常了,谢谢。
不过现在在用r387的时候,在stalonetry托盘上看不到fcitx的图标了,
请问可能是什么原因呢?
按configure的help加--enable-tray参数后编译,提示如下错误:
代码:
In function `main': /backup/Download/fcitx-read-utf8/src/core/main.c:233: undefined reference to `tray' /backup/Download/fcitx-read-utf8/src/core/main.c:235: undefined reference to `CreateTrayWindow' /backup/Download/fcitx-read-utf8/src/core/main.c:236: undefined reference to `tray' /backup/Download/fcitx-read-utf8/src/core/main.c:236: undefined reference to `DrawTrayWindow' /backup/Download/fcitx-read-utf8/src/core/main.c:233: undefined reference to `tray' ../tools/libtools.a(tools.o):(.data+0x48): undefined reference to `bUseTrayIcon' collect2: ld 返回 1 make[3]: *** [fcitx] 错误 1 make[3]: Leaving directory `/backup/Download/fcitx-read-utf8/src/core' make[2]: *** [all-recursive] 错误 1 make[2]: Leaving directory `/backup/Download/fcitx-read-utf8/src' make[1]: *** [all-recursive] 错误 1 make[1]: Leaving directory `/backup/Download/fcitx-read-utf8' make: *** [all] 错误 2


===============================
找到原因了,这次是网络问题,文件有错误,重新更新了一下,加--enable-tray参数就正常了。
改编译参数需要make clean,嗯
  hurricanek 当前离线   回复时引用此帖
发表新主题 回复


主题工具

发帖规则
您 [不可以] 发表新主题
您 [不可以] 回复主题
您 [不可以] 上传附件
您 [不可以] 编辑您的帖子

已 [启用] BB 代码
已 [启用] 表情符号
已 [禁用] IMG 代码
已 [禁用] HTML 代码
[论坛跳转…]


所有时间均为[北京时间]。现在的时间是 07:02


Powered by vBulletin 版本 3.6.8
版权所有 ©2000 - 2012, Jelsoft Enterprises Ltd.
官方中文技术支持: vBulletin 中文
版权所有 ©2002 - 2011, LinuxSir.Org